Experience Einaudi: A live piano event with Daniel J Collins

Discover a thought provoking hour of live piano music influenced by Ludovico Einaudi and Joep Beving. With insights from Daniel J Collins, this event aims to build deep stories and bring memories to the forefront of your mind.

Daniel J. Collins is a pianist, tutor, and composer from Worcestershire whose musical journey has been anything but ordinary. After buying his first piano in 2013 Daniel has carved out a rich and expressive career that continues to captivate audiences.

His work spans multiple single releases, two full albums, and a series of memorable performances at remarkable venues, including Croome Court, Hartlebury Castle, and along the stunning River Rhine in Germany. Known for his emotive playing style and his ability to create an atmosphere that lingers long after the final note, Daniel champions the value of owning physical music, and experiencing live, thought‑provoking performances that bring people together.
